About M. H. Bryan

M. H. Bryan is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, Surgery and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 63 papers that have together received 3.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(40 papers),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(23 papers), Infant Nutrition and Health (13 papers),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Studies (13 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(12 papers), Infant Development and Preterm Care (12 papers), Infant Health and Development (10 papers) and Breastfeeding Practices and Influences (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(1.1k cit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(2.2k cit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(846 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(506 citations) and Pharmacy (121 citations). M. H. Bryan has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include A. C. Bryan, G. Harvey Anderson, Stephanie A. Atkinson, P Duffty, A Olinsky, S Zlotkin, José Maria de Andrade Lopes, Néstor L. Müller, S. J. England and Peter Fleming.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Applied Physiology, The Journal of Pediatrics, PEDIATRICS, Pediatric Research and American Journal of Clinical Nutrition.
